I don't live as far up as the sportsman pub, in fact I don't live as far up as the tall flats, but my postal address is Stannington; once upon a time I think where I live fell within Malin Bridge but the boundaries changed in 60's so its now in Stannington.

 

Possibly when Stannington Village ceased to be part of Wortley District Council and was swallowed up into the metropolis that is called Sheffield.

That was a sad day and opened the floodgates of claims that the areas of Deer Park, Stanwood, Roscoe Bank and the Woodlands were now part of Stannington. Sounds better I suppose :)
